Transaction 056d9dd3946c2b85f34fcc859486a67d9935a018b88dc17ded4dfa61ff84e648
2 Input
2 Outputs
- 056d9dd3946c2b85f34fcc859486a67d9935a018b88dc17ded4dfa61ff84e648:0
- 056d9dd3946c2b85f34fcc859486a67d9935a018b88dc17ded4dfa61ff84e648:1
value 24490592
address 3CQr3W6tYs5DwLNyNH8JvGvda4RFJaee2b
value 1664370
address 1PPFXqScsxwguaQWkDjsVEdUW7ZU7TCsET